Contents:
Solo across the Atlantic -- Early years -- Tomboy -- Maverick -- First flight -- Social work and aviation -- Celebrity -- Queen of the air -- Flights and more flights -- Around the world.
Summary: A biography of Amelia Earhart who, four years after becoming the first woman passenger to fly across the Atlantic Ocean, became the first woman pilot to do so, as well.
